2003 - Can't connect to MySQL server on 'localhost' (10061 "Unknown error") navicat报这个
时间: 2024-10-20 12:01:43 浏览: 28
NavicatforMySQL-9数据库工具.rar
2003年的错误提示"Can't connect to MySQL server on 'localhost' (10061 Unknown error)"通常发生在Navicat尝试连接本地MySQL数据库服务器时遇到问题。具体来说:
1. **网络问题**:可能是由于网络连接故障,如防火墙阻止了Navicat对MySQL的访问,或者计算机没有正确配置到MySQL服务。
2. **MySQL服务未运行**:如果你的MySQL服务没有正常启动,或者在系统启动时没有自动启动,也会导致这个错误。
3. **权限或认证问题**:登录凭证可能不正确,比如用户名、密码错误,或者用户没有足够的权限连接到指定的数据库。
4. **端口问题**:默认的MySQL监听端口(通常是3306)可能被其他应用占用,或者你正在使用的不是默认端口。
5. **系统级别限制**:有些操作系统可能会限制非root用户直接访问MySQL。
要解决这个问题,你可以按照以下步骤操作:
1. 检查MySQL服务是否正在运行。
2. 确认Navicat的连接设置,包括主机名、用户名、密码以及端口号是否正确。
3. 确保网络环境无障碍,并检查防火墙设置。
4. 如果是权限问题,确认你的账户是否有正确的连接权限。
5. 尝试重启MySQL服务,清理网络缓存或者临时关闭防火墙试试。
阅读全文